VPN连不上网?别慌!网络工程师教你一步步排查与解决

admin11 2026-01-29 免费VPN 3 0

当你的VPN连接突然中断、无法访问目标网站或提示“无法连接到服务器”时,很多用户的第一反应是“是不是公司/学校的防火墙封了?”或者“是不是我的电脑中毒了?”这种情况并不罕见,大多数问题都可以通过系统性排查快速定位和解决,作为一名资深网络工程师,我来手把手带你从基础到进阶,一步步排查并修复“VPN连不上网”的问题。

确认最基础的网络状态,请先检查本地网络是否正常:打开浏览器尝试访问任意网站(如百度、Google),如果连普通网页都无法打开,说明你当前的网络环境有问题,比如Wi-Fi断开、DNS异常或运营商故障,此时应重启路由器、更换网络(例如用手机热点测试),或联系ISP客服。

如果本地网络正常,再检查VPN客户端本身,有些用户安装的是第三方软件(如OpenVPN、WireGuard、Cisco AnyConnect等),可能因版本过旧、配置文件损坏或证书失效导致连接失败,建议你:

  1. 退出并重新启动VPN客户端;
  2. 删除旧的配置文件,重新导入新的配置(尤其适用于企业或学校部署的专线VPN);
  3. 检查是否启用了代理设置(某些杀毒软件或浏览器插件会干扰流量路由);
  4. 更新客户端至最新版本(官网下载,避免使用破解版);

第三步,重点排查防火墙与安全软件,Windows自带的防火墙、第三方杀毒软件(如360、卡巴斯基、McAfee)常会误判VPN流量为威胁行为,从而阻止其通信,你可以暂时关闭防火墙和杀毒软件测试是否恢复连接,若成功,则需在安全软件中添加VPN程序为白名单,或允许其通过特定端口(如UDP 500、4500用于IPsec,TCP 443用于SSL/TLS)。

第四步,检查服务器端状态,如果你使用的不是个人搭建的VPN(如ExpressVPN、NordVPN等商用服务),而是单位内部的远程访问系统,可能是服务器宕机、负载过高或认证失败(如用户名密码错误),此时应联系IT支持团队,提供具体错误代码(如“Error 1722”、“Connection timed out”),以便他们快速响应。

第五步,高级排查——使用命令行工具,在Windows命令提示符中输入以下命令:

  • ping <vpn_server_ip>:判断是否能通;
  • tracert <vpn_server_ip>:查看路径中哪一跳延迟高或丢包;
  • ipconfig /all:确认本地IP地址是否获取成功(尤其是DHCP分配的地址);
  • netsh interface show interface:检查虚拟网卡(如TAP-Windows Adapter)是否启用。

如果以上步骤都无效,可以尝试重置网络栈(Windows下运行:netsh winsock reset + netsh int ip reset),然后重启电脑。

VPN连不上网的问题,往往不是单一原因造成的,它可能涉及本地网络、客户端配置、防火墙策略、服务器状态等多个层面,建议你按“从简单到复杂”的顺序逐层排查,切忌盲目重装系统或频繁切换设备,作为网络工程师,我们解决问题的核心思路永远是:观察现象 → 缩小范围 → 验证假设 → 解决问题。

下次再遇到类似问题,不妨按这个流程走一遍,你会发现:原来网络问题也可以这么清晰明了地搞定!

VPN连不上网?别慌!网络工程师教你一步步排查与解决